5. Enhancing Problem-Solving Skills
At the heart of every brain teaser lies a challenge that must be unraveled, and therein lies their power to enhance problem-solving skills. These puzzles encourage individuals to approach problems methodically, analyzing various scenarios and crafting thought-out solutions. Such engagement is not merely theoretical; the skills sharpened by these puzzles are directly transferable to everyday life, whether one is navigating complex projects at work or personal issues at home.
Consider the classic logic puzzle. The player must often identify a pattern or sequence, hypothesize possible solutions, and iteratively test their hypotheses until the correct answer is found. This process mirrors real-life decision-making, where individuals must assess objectives, gather information, explore alternatives, and draw conclusions. By fostering these habits, brain teasers serve as invaluable training grounds for enhancing problem-solving capabilities across diverse situations.
4. Stress Relief and Relaxation
While mental challenges might appear to demand effort, they also offer a surprising remedy for anxiety: stress relief. Engrossing oneself in a puzzle can serve as an effective distraction from life’s pressures, momentarily shifting focus from stressors to a singular, engaging task. This absorption into the realm of cognitive focus is known as “flow,” a state of concentrated enjoyment that reduces cortisol, the stress hormone.
Beyond immediate relaxation, studies have shown that successfully solving a puzzle releases dopamine, a neurotransmitter that contributes to feelings of reward and satisfaction. This chemical reaction within the brain fosters not only a sense of accomplishment but also triggers pleasure responses akin to those experienced after exercise. Therefore, engaging regularly in brain teasers can lead to a sustained reduction in stress levels, promoting a more tranquil and balanced lifestyle.
3. Memory Improvement
The third substantial advantage of brain teasers is their ability to improve memory. Whether they involve recalling the placement of pieces in a jigsaw puzzle or memorizing sequences in patterns, these activities require the brain to utilize both short-term and long-term memory, reinforcing these neural pathways.
Crossword puzzles and Sudoku, for example, stimulate various sections of the brain responsible for different memories — procedural, semantic, and working memory. Regular engagement in such puzzles has been documented to bolster brain plasticity, essentially exercising the mind to prevent age-related cognitive decline. This effect has profound implications, especially for older adults, suggesting that brain teasers can play a role in delaying the onset of memory-related conditions such as dementia.

Frequently Asked Questions About the Benefits of Brain Teasers for Mental Health
What exactly are brain teasers and how do they work?
Brain teasers are puzzles or riddles that challenge the brain to think creatively and critically. They often require out-of-the-box thinking and can stimulate multiple areas of the brain. By engaging with brain teasers, individuals utilize problem-solving skills, memory, and logical reasoning. This can lead to enhanced cognitive function, as it encourages the brain to form new neural connections and pathways.
Can brain teasers really improve mental health?
There is evidence to suggest that brain teasers can have a positive impact on mental health. Engaging in these activities can lead to increased mental resilience and reduced stress levels. They provide a form of mental exercise that can improve both concentration and mental agility. Research has shown that consistent mental stimulation can help delay cognitive decline associated with aging, making brain teasers a valuable part of a mental wellness routine.
Are there long-term benefits to solving brain teasers regularly?
Yes, solving brain teasers regularly can provide long-term cognitive benefits. Regular engagement with complex puzzles can enhance memory retention, improve problem-solving abilities, and maintain overall brain health. Moreover, the habit of tackling challenging mental tasks encourages the brain to adapt and strengthen over time, potentially delaying the onset of diseases such as dementia and Alzheimer’s.
Do brain teasers alone suffice for maintaining mental health?
While brain teasers are beneficial, they should ideally be part of a broader strategy for maintaining mental health. This strategy could include physical exercise, a balanced diet, social interaction, and adequate sleep—all crucial components for mental well-being. Combining brain teasers with these healthy lifestyle choices can create a holistic approach to mental health maintenance.
